Homicide Cases

Homicide, also known as the deliberate and unlawful killing of another person, can be charged as either murder or manslaughter. In the state of California, there are two main degrees of murder: first degree murder, which is the willful, deliberate and premeditated killing of another with aggravating circumstances, and second-degree murder, defined as any intentional killing that is not premeditated.
